Knowing when to double the consonant and drop silent e are important steps as students grow into strong spellers. These rules can be especially tricky after an initial exposure to suffixes that focuses on simply adding a suffix to a base word.
What rules for suffixes are covered?
- Double the consonant – Teach students to double the final consonant if the base word ends in a short vowel followed by a single consonant.
- Drop Silent e – Students learn to drop the silent e on base words before adding ing or ed.
